Earth Day crafts are a great way to introduce your child to the spirit of Earth Day.
When is Earth Day? It’s April 22nd, so it’s time to round up and share our Earth Day activities. What I love about Earth Day is that there are so many angles you can take. The 3 Rs – Reduce, Re-Use and Recycle is a great way to start. You can also focus on learning about how the Earth works, how we are taking from it and how we can try to give back. The Earth Day crafts for kids listed here are all hands on ways to teach your child about our beautiful planet.
